( November 14, 2024, 07:05 GMT | Press Round-Up Europe) -- Contents: - Novo Nordisk rivals get EU questions on Catalent deal - Charter Communications to take over Liberty Broadband - Biontech to buy Chinese cancer treatment specialist Biotheus - BBVA prepares remedies to secure Sabadell deal - Visa confirms EU regulator probing fees charged to retailers - Meta sued in US over Instagram, WhatsApp takeovers - EU court upholds approval of Vodafone, Liberty Global deal - European socialists object to Ribera opposition in EU ParliamentEU antitrust regulators have sent questions to Novo Nordisk’s rivals and customers asking about four business areas in the context of its planned $16.5 billion takeover of contract manufacturer Catalent. The questionnaire seeks feedback on vertical links in parts of the contract development and manufacturing organization industry, including injectables, pre-filled syringes, orally dissolved pills, and soft gels....
